go astray
verb
Meaning
- To develop bad habits; to behave improperly or illegally.
- To behave in an adulterous manner.
- To come to believe an untruth.
- (of an object) To become lost or mislaid.
- (chiefly in the negative) To be undesirable or unhelpful.
